Flat Glass Cutting and Fitting Worker
Specialist in interior finishing who measures and cuts flat glass, and secures and fits it into frames using sealing materials, etc.
Mirror Installer
Specialist who safely and beautifully installs mirrors in building interiors.
Steel Substrate Assembly Worker
A job involving cutting, processing, and assembling steel framing (studs, channels, angles, etc.) used to attach interior materials such as plasterboard in construction work.
Sash Worker
Specialized interior worker who installs and adjusts aluminum or steel sashes used for building window frames and door frames on site, ensuring airtightness and thermal insulation.
Lead Sheet Lining Worker
Interior finishing worker who attaches lead sheets to walls, ceilings, and floors for radiation shielding. Works in hospital X-ray rooms, experimental facilities, etc.
Blind Installer
Occupation that installs blinds indoors in buildings, adjusts them, and performs maintenance.
Plastic Tile Floor Installer
Craftsman/technician who applies plastic tiles to floor surfaces and finishes them.
Plastic Floor Installer
A craftsman who installs plastic flooring materials such as vinyl tiles and long sheets on floors in buildings, commercial facilities, medical facilities, etc., and handles interior finishing.
